The 2023 San Diego State Aztecs football team represented San Diego State University as a member of the Mountain West Conference during the 2023 NCAA Division I FBS football season. They were led by head coach Brady Hoke, who coached his sixth season with the team. [1] The Aztecs played their home games at Snapdragon Stadium in San Diego.
The 1997 San Diego State Aztecs football team represented San Diego State University during the 1997 NCAA Division I-A football season as a member of the Western Athletic Conference (WAC). The team was led by head coach Ted Tollner, in his third year. They played home games at Jack Murphy Stadium [note 1] in San Diego, California.

The 1995 San Diego State Aztecs football team represented San Diego State University during the 1995 NCAA Division I-A football season as a member of the Western Athletic Conference (WAC). The team was led by head coach Ted Tollner, in his second year. They played home games at Jack Murphy Stadium [note 1] in San Diego.

The 2010 San Diego State Aztecs football team represented San Diego State University in the 2010 NCAA Division I FBS football season. The team was coached by second-year head coach Brady Hoke and played their home games in Qualcomm Stadium in San Diego, California. They are members of the Mountain West Conference.
